Editorial Peter Rowlands peter@uwpmag.com Saluting Snoots I think it’s fair to say that underwater photography equipment accessories start out as an attempt to sell us more ‘gear’; something to help us take different images that will stand out from the crowd in competitions but discarded when too many similar shots kept popping up. A good example is the Magic Tube whose images initially caught the eye but then became tedious as it was extremely hard to find a subject that suited the technique. And yet the lack of success in competitions didn’t seem to deter entrants. The snoot, on the other hand, hit the scene with a bang with a shot from Keri Wilk entitled ‘Stargazer Eyes’ and after an early dodgy period when people just shot the wrong subjects, the techique lasted as more and more photographers chose the right subjects and different angles.
